Measurement of horizontal load subjected to aeroplane undercarriage tyre

  •   The mathematic model of predicting the horizontal load subjected to aeroplane undercarriage tyre based on the drop-tests was built by analyzing dynamic loads acting on drop-test platform which is supported by three-poles, and the coefficients in the mathematic model were determined by means of the least-square method according to the results of static tests. Then the horizontal load to aeroplane undercarriage tyre can be obtained more accurately by making use of the proposed model and results of drop-test simultaneously. The practical usesof the proposed method shows that it is more reasonable and more reliable than the method used in former Russia.
